CHAPIN SCHOOL STUDENT CARSON VEY TOP SCHOLAR ATHLETE RECEPIENT
Carson Vey, an eighth grade student attending Chapin School in Princeton, was recently recognized as a top Youth Scholar Athlete of the year by the National Football Foundation and College Hall of Fame, Delaware Valley Chapter. Vey was selected for his academic, leadership and athletic achievements. “Carson is a leader in the classroom, on the football field and a role model for his teammates and peers,” stated his Coach Don Wiley.
In addition, Vey has received several other recognitions including: 2010 Pop Warner National All-American Scholar Athlete, selected to the 2011 Pop Warner Eastern Region Scholar Athlete Team. Vey has recently again been named a 2011 Pop Warner National All-American Scholar Athlete Award recipient.
Vey has attended Chapin School for the past ten years and plans to attend Peddie School in the fall. Carson also is enjoys basketball, lacrosse, and the saxophone.
Chapin School is a pre-kindergarten thru eighth grade school located in Princeton, New Jersey.
